What is on site at Paradise Palms Resort

What is actually on site

Paradise Palms is our value resort, and the honest framing is that it does the essentials well rather than competing on spectacle. There is no lazy river and no surf simulator. What there is: a large lagoon-style community pool with a waterfall and a covered grotto, two hot tubs, a water slide, a separate children's pool, and a licensed tiki bar and grill serving the pool deck.

Indoors the clubhouse carries a movie theatre that costs nothing to use, an arcade and games room, a gym, a sundry shop and a lounge. Outside there are tennis, basketball and volleyball courts. Homes are mostly townhomes and smaller pool homes, four to six bedrooms — our 4 bedroom vacation homes page covers the size most guests book here.

The trade-off is worth stating plainly: you get a shorter drive to Disney than most of our resorts and a lower nightly cost, in exchange for a smaller amenity set. For a family whose week is mostly park days, that is often the right trade.

Paradise Palms questions we're asked most

Why is Paradise Palms cheaper than the other resorts?

It's a smaller, older community with mostly townhomes rather than large detached villas, so nightly rates sit lower — while still giving you a gated resort, clubhouse, slide pool and tiki bar.

Do the townhomes have their own pool?

Most have a private screened splash pool in the rear courtyard, separate from the clubhouse pool. Every listing states whether the home has one and whether it can be heated.

Is it suitable for a large group?

Up to about fourteen in one home. Beyond that we'd point you to Reunion or ChampionsGate — or book two neighbouring Paradise Palms homes together.

How far is the walk to the clubhouse?

Two to five minutes from almost every home. It's the most compact resort we work with, which is a real advantage with small children.

What amenities does Paradise Palms Resort have?

A large lagoon-style community pool with a waterfall, covered grotto and water slide, two hot tubs, a separate children's pool and a licensed tiki bar and grill. Indoors there is a free movie theatre, an arcade and games room, a gym with a sauna, and a sundry shop. Tennis, basketball and volleyball courts sit outside.

Does Paradise Palms Resort have a lazy river?

No. Paradise Palms has a large lagoon-style pool with a waterfall, a grotto and a water slide, but no lazy river and no water park. If a lazy river is what your group wants, Storey Lake, ChampionsGate, Windsor Island and Windsor at Westside all have one.

Is Paradise Palms Resort good value?

It is the resort we suggest when budget matters most. The amenity set is smaller than Reunion or Encore, but the drive to Disney is shorter than most and the nightly cost is lower. For a family spending most of the week in the parks, that trade usually works out well.

How far is Paradise Palms Resort from Disney World?

Roughly five miles, usually about ten minutes by car — the resort describes itself as just minutes from Disney. It also publishes seventeen miles to Universal Orlando, which is around half an hour depending on I-4 traffic.

Is the movie theatre at Paradise Palms free?

Yes — the resort makes a point of it being free to use, which is not universal. It sits in the clubhouse alongside the arcade and games room, the gym and the lounge, so there is somewhere to go on a wet afternoon without spending anything.

What size homes are at Paradise Palms Resort?

Ours run from four to six bedrooms, mostly townhomes and smaller pool homes. It is the smallest of our resorts by inventory, so availability moves quickly — filtering by your dates is the fastest way to see what is genuinely open.

Is there a gym at Paradise Palms Resort?

Yes, a fitness centre in the clubhouse with a sauna alongside it. There are also tennis, basketball and volleyball courts outdoors if you would rather be in the Florida air than on a treadmill.

Is there food at Paradise Palms Resort?

A licensed tiki bar and grill serves the pool deck, and the clubhouse has a sundry shop and deli for essentials and light food. For a proper grocery shop the nearest Publix is around two miles away, about five minutes by car.
